Why does the mother have to carry a baby with anencephaly?
A mother may carry a baby with anencephaly due to various reasons, including a desire to experience the pregnancy and bond with the baby, even if the infant is not expected to survive long after birth. Some parents may also want to give their child the chance to be born and may find comfort in the time spent during the pregnancy. Additionally, medical advice and personal beliefs can influence the decision to continue the pregnancy despite the diagnosis. Ultimately, the choice is deeply personal and can vary significantly among families.
What is a baby kept warm by in intensive care?
In intensive care, a baby is kept warm by using an incubator or a radiant warmer. An incubator provides a controlled environment with regulated temperature, humidity, and oxygen levels, while a radiant warmer uses overhead heaters to maintain the baby's body temperature. Both methods help prevent hypothermia and support the baby's overall health and development.
